Key Specifications Overview:
Physical Dimensions: 86mm diameter, 249.2mm total length—compact structure, ideal for embedded designs.
Electrical Specifications: 6 high-current channels (16A) + 3 independent signal channels.
Fluid Specifications: 4 independent fluid circuits, enabling efficient pneumatic/hydraulic transmission.
Environmental Adaptability: IP65 protection rating; operating temperature range of -20°C to +60°C.
